ENTER THE BURPEE

The burpee isn’t just an exercise — it’s a customizable full-body weapon. Think of it as a sandwich: squat + plank = bread. Everything in between is the meat. Add a push-up → classic 6-count. Add an 8-count jump-jack → adductors on fire. Add rotational kick-throughs → transverse plane chaos most people never train.

Whether you’re brand new or a conditioning beast, this guide gives you the exact progression to conquer the most loved-and-hated move in fitness. No equipment. No excuses. Just decide how meaty you want your sandwich.

COMBAT LOAD TRAINING

Combat load training focuses on preparing individuals to effectively carry, maneuver, and operate with the gear and equipment required in real-world tactical scenarios. This training emphasizes weight distribution, endurance, and movement efficiency while wearing body armor, weapons, ammunition, and other mission-essential items. By simulating the physical demands of actual combat situations, practitioners build strength, stamina, and familiarity with their load, reducing fatigue and improving overall performance under stress. Incorporating combat load training into regular practice ensures readiness and adaptability in dynamic environments.
